Defense Logistics Agency award SPE4A626F343Z is a delivery order issued under the base contract SPE4A622D0124 to Meg Technologies, Inc. (CAGE 6W912) for the procurement of quick release pins (NSN/Part 5315013951138). The specific award, dated August 17, 2026, is valued at 1,477.84 dollars. The broader base contract, which began on May 4, 2022, is an indefinite-quantity agreement with an estimated total value of 164,507.98 dollars across multiple line items, including various bolts and rivets. The contract period extends through May 3, 2027, with provisions for four option years to extend the term up to a maximum of 60 months. The contract is administered by DLA Aviation, ASC Commodities Division, with Alan Stanley serving as the Contracting Officer. Deliveries are made FOB Origin to multiple destinations within the continental United States, with lead times ranging from 196 to 350 days after receipt of order. Inspection and acceptance are conducted by the government at the destination. Invoicing must be processed electronically through the Wide Area WorkFlow system. Compliance requirements include adherence to NIST SP 800-171 and DFARS 252.204-7012 for safeguarding covered defense information, and all packaging, preservation, and marking must conform to the specifications detailed in the PID, Packaging, and Marking attachment.

The Defense Logistics Agency, through DLA Land and Maritime, has issued Request for Quotations SPE7L7-26-Q-2412 for the procurement of 100 nickel-cadmium wet storage batteries (NSN 6140-01-241-2296). These batteries are specified as wet, discharged, and spillable, with a non-extendable shelf life of 36 months. Approved sources include Aerodesign, Inc. (P/N AD-31004-04C) and Marathonnorco Aerospace, Inc. (P/N 31004-04C). The items are to be delivered to the Royal Saudi Air Force within 60 days after the order date. This is a fixed-price solicitation where award will be based on the best value to the government, evaluating technical conformity, past performance, and offered delivery time. Because the batteries are classified as corrosive materials (UN2795), the contractor must strictly adhere to hazardous materials regulations, including ICAO, IMDG, 49 CFR, and AFJMAN 24-204. Packaging must comply with MIL-STD-2073-1E Level B, Pack Code Q, using 4G fiber-board boxes. Inspection will be conducted by DCMA at the distributor or OEM site, with acceptance occurring at the origin. Administrative requirements include the use of the Wide Area WorkFlow system for electronic invoicing and receiving reports. The contract incorporates various FAR and DFARS clauses, including the Buy American and Balance of Payments Program and strict cybersecurity reporting requirements under DFARS 252.204-7012. Quotes must be submitted electronically by the deadline of September 17, 2026.
